Making Contact. Encounters of the Second Kind

So we are still looking for that perfect person on design firm to create that new project that is going to send your business into the stratosphere. Yesterday we looked at people that we know well, friends, family, that kid down the block that built his own Myspace page or whoever. Maybe we found the right person maybe not. Today is all about using those business connections that we all have made over the years in a different way.

Every small business owner that you know that has a website probably has worked with a web designer at some point. Or else they probably wouldn’t have that site. So should you use the same person or design firm that did their site? Maybe yes, maybe no. Do you really, really like their site and wish that your site looked exactly the same? Then yes look into working with that designer. However every situation is different. What are your needs? Are you going to need additional services that they cannot or do not provide such as print work. It all depends on if you want to build a relationship with a web designer and a graphic artist or just one. That being said not every great web designer is a great print graphic designer. Ask to see examples of both if you are looking for a full service designer.

Please do everyone a favor though and not ask your business connection how much they paid for their website or print work. The reason for this is simple. All projects are different. What he or she needed is different than what you need, it could cost more or it could cost less, either way don’t put your business connection in that position of revealing what they paid. Get the quote from the designer that you are interested in working with. And whatever you do don’t say “Well, you only charged so-and-so this.”
